Zero knowledge based client side deduplication for encrypted files of secure cloud storage in smart cities

被引:12
|
作者
Yang, Chao [1 ]
Zhang, Mingyue [1 ]
Jiang, Qi [1 ]
Zhang, Junwei [1 ]
Li, Danping [1 ]
Ma, Jianfeng [1 ]
Ren, Jian [2 ]
机构
[1] Xidian Univ, Sch Cyber Engn, Xian 710071, Shaanxi, Peoples R China
[2] Michigan State Univ, Dept ECE, E Lansing, MI 48824 USA
关键词
Cloud storage; Deduplication; Encrypted files; Zero knowledge; Proxy re-encryption; SERVICES;
D O I
10.1016/j.pmcj.2017.03.014
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
As typical applications in the field of the cloud computing, cloud storage services are popular in the development of smart cities for their low costs and huge storage capacity. Proofs-of-ownership (PoW) is an important cryptographic primitive in cloud storage to ensure that a client holds the whole file rather than part of it in secure client side data deduplication. The previous PoW schemes worked well when the file is in plaintext. However, the privacy of the clients' data may be vulnerable to honest-but-curious attacks. To deal with this issue, the clients tend to encrypt files before outsourcing them to the cloud, which makes the existing PoW schemes inapplicable any more. In this paper, we first propose a secure zero-knowledge based client side deduplication scheme over encrypted files. We prove that the proposed scheme is sound, complete and zero-knowledge. The scheme can achieve a high detection probability of the clients' misbehavior. Then we introduced a proxy re-encryption based key distribution scheme. This scheme ensures that the server knows nothing about the encryption key even though it acts as a proxy to help distributing the file encryption key. It also enables the clients who have gained the ownership of a file to share the file with the encryption key generated without establishing secure channels among them. It is proved that the clients' private key cannot be recovered by the server or clients collusion attacks during the key distribution phase. Our performance evaluation shows that the proposed scheme is much more efficient than the existing client side deduplication schemes. (C) 2017 Elsevier B.V. All rights reserved.
引用
收藏
页码:243 / 258
页数:16
相关论文
共 50 条
  • [1] A Secure Client Side Deduplication Scheme in Cloud Storage Environments
    Kaaniche, Nesrine
    Laurent, Maryline
    [J]. 2014 6TH INTERNATIONAL CONFERENCE ON NEW TECHNOLOGIES, MOBILITY AND SECURITY (NTMS), 2014,
  • [2] Public Auditing for Encrypted Data with Client-Side Deduplication in Cloud Storage
    HE Kai
    HUANG Chuanhe
    ZHOU Hao
    SHI Jiaoli
    WANG Xiaomao
    DAN Feng
    [J]. Wuhan University Journal of Natural Sciences, 2015, 20 (04) : 291 - 298
  • [3] CSED: Client-Side encrypted deduplication scheme based on proofs of ownership for cloud storage
    Li, Shanshan
    Xu, Chunxiang
    Zhang, Yuan
    [J]. JOURNAL OF INFORMATION SECURITY AND APPLICATIONS, 2019, 46 : 250 - 258
  • [4] Efficient Client-Side Deduplication of Encrypted Data With Public Auditing in Cloud Storage
    Youn, Taek-Young
    Chang, Ku-Young
    Rhee, Kyung-Hyune
    Shin, Sang Uk
    [J]. IEEE ACCESS, 2018, 6 : 26578 - 26587
  • [5] ClouDedup: Secure Deduplication with Encrypted Data for Cloud Storage
    Puzio, Pasquale
    Molva, Refik
    Oenen, Melek
    Loureiro, Sergio
    [J]. 2013 IEEE FIFTH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ING TECHNOLOGY AND SCIENCE (CLOUDCOM), VOL 1, 2013, : 363 - 370
  • [6] Secure and efficient client-side data deduplication with public auditing in cloud storage
    Dang, Qianlong
    Ma, Hua
    Liu, Zhenhua
    Xie, Ying
    [J]. International Journal of Network Security, 2020, 22 (03) : 462 - 475
  • [7] SecReS: A Secure and Reliable Storage Scheme for Cloud with Client-side Data Deduplication
    Islam, Tariqul
    Mistareehi, Hassan
    Manivannan, D.
    [J]. 2019 IEEE GLOBAL COMMUNICATIONS CONFERENCE (GLOBECOM), 2019,
  • [8] Attribute-Based Storage Supporting Secure Deduplication of Encrypted Data in Cloud
    Cui, Hui
    Deng, Robert H.
    Li, Yingjiu
    Wu, Guowei
    [J]. IEEE TRANSACTIONS ON BIG DATA, 2019, 5 (03) : 330 - 342
  • [9] Zero knowledge based data deduplication using in-line Block Matching protocol for secure cloud storage
    Kanagamani, Vivekrabinson
    Karuppiah, Muneeswaran
    [J]. TURKISH JOURNAL OF ELECTRICAL ENGINEERING AND COMPUTER SCIENCES, 2021, 29 (04) : 2067 - 2083
  • [10] Secure and Efficient Deduplication over Encrypted Data with Dynamic Updates in Cloud Storage
    Koo, Dongyoung
    Hur, Junbeom
    Yoon, Hyunsoo
    [J]. FRONTIER AND INNOVATION IN FUTURE COMPUTING AND COMMUNICATIONS, 2014, 301 : 229 - 235